7ohm is in the neighborhood of 40 times more potent as far as direct antinociceptive effects than Mitra...so even 0.05%*40=2% equivalency to Mit

And it's true that it appears the Mit is probably converted into 7ohm by the cytochrome P450 pathway at least in the mouse and rat model so if even a very small percentage is converted in humans (which is not always a direct correlation) it will result in much greater effects on pain.

All of that aside, what I know is the strains that I have that have been tested for higher than average 7ohm levels result in much greater relief, at least for me. The strains that have higher levels of Mit tend to be much more stimulating. There's far more complexity going on with this plant than just the Mit. There's hundreds of research articles out there looking at interaction with various receptors but they are often looking primarily at just these two alkaloids and there's a whole host of others that we understand very little about.
